Dr. Usha Kiran is working with Jamia Hamdard University, New Delhi. She is investigating the use of bioinformatic tools to study signalling modulators that are being used by plant cells to evoke protective cellular response, especially proline biosynthesis and degradation during stress conditions. She has published one book (Plant Biotechnology: Principles and Application) in the capacity of co-editor. Dr. Malik Zainul Abdin is Professor of Biotechnology in Jamia Hamdard’s School of Chemical and Life Sciences, India. He obtained his B.S. from Aligarh Muslim University and his Ph.D. from the Indian Agricultural Research Institute. Professor Abdin specializes in plant biotechnology, plant-derived therapeutics, and phytopharmaceutical innovation. His work spans metabolic engineering, molecular genetics, and bioactive compound stabilization. He brings more than three decades of research and teaching experience to the project, and has edited six prior volumes, including Elsevier’s Transgenic Technology Based Value Addition in Plant Biotechnology. Dr. Kamaluddin is an Associate Professor in the Department of Genetics and Plant Breeding at Banda University of Agriculture and Plant Technology. He is an author of 36 research articles, 3 review articles, 10 Book chapters and 2 Practical manuals. He also served as editor of the 2017 book "Plant Biotechnology: Principles and Applications".
